I did the Bioclean (Optim and Digest) for the first six weeks. I then started the booster week 7 and every week after that. I was then doing the optim and digest every other week. Therefore, starting week 7 it would be Optim,digest and booster. Week 8 just booster. Week 9 all three and so and so on. I get my Warner Marine products from my LFS or Marine Depot.

Husky- Booster is vitamin, amino, fatty acid supplement that is well regarded overseas. You can also use it in place of selcon or vita-chem to enrich foods.
 
You will have to turn off the skimmer for Reefbooter or it will over skim. I dose in the late evening, then tun on the skimmer the next morning.

I turned off the UV completely.

As for the other additives, I leave the skimmer on.
